Williams’ Request for Redistricting Hearing Rebuffed

Harrisburg – September 19, 2017 – State Sen. Anthony H. Williams’ (D-Philadelphia) request for a hearing on redistricting reform measures was rejected by the chair of the Senate State Government Committee due to “pending litigation on the drawing of maps,” Williams said today.

Williams Sends HBO’s Oliver a “Dear John” Letter

Harrisburg – Aug. 25, 2016 – State Sen. Anthony H. Williams (D-Philadephia/Delaware) released the following letter that he sent to John Oliver, host of “Last Week Tonight with John Oliver.”

In the letter, Williams calls into question an assertion made in Oliver’s recent show that Pennsylvania’s “charter schools are terrible.” Williams also took exception to Oliver’s characterization that Pennsylvania has “the worst football fans, the worst bell, and the worst regional delicacy”.
